About this role
Engineering Manager El Paso, TX JOB TITLE: Engineering Services Manager LOCATION NAME: El Paso, TX COUNTRY: USA BUSINESS UNIT: Systems Protection Group REPORTS TO: Plant Manager MATRIX TO: n/a DIRECT REPORTS: Manufacturing Engineers, Engineering Clerk, Process Engineer FUNCTION: Operations REVISION LEVEL: Rev 12 REVISION DATE: 4/1/2026 SUMMARY: The Engineering Services Manager is responsible for leading and coordinating engineering services that support safe, efficient, and reliable manufacturing operations. This role owns plant-level engineering support functions including maintenance engineering, utilities, infrastructure, equipment reliability, and capital project execution. Acting as the primary interface between Operations, Maintenance, Quality, EHS, and Corporate Engineering, the Engineering Services Manager ensures engineering standards are met while driving continuous improvement in equipment performance, cost, compliance, and capacity utilization. RESPONSIBILITIES: Lead and manage engineering services activities supporting production, maintenance, and plant infrastructure. Provide technical expertise for troubleshooting equipment, process, and facility-related issues. Ensure engineering solutions align with plant goals for safety, quality, delivery, and cost. Establish and maintain engineering standards, specifications, and best practices. Partner with Maintenance and Operations to improve equipment reliability, uptime, and performance.
